How to read these numbers
- Committed to this recipient
The dollars agencies committed to them — signed contracts and awarded grants — counted in the year each action happened.
- Lifetime vs. a single year
The profile sections cover the recipient's full history on record; the headline total and the flow bar reflect the fiscal year picked at the top.
- “Active in FY X”
A fiscal-year award list shows every award with at least one action that year, at its full lifetime value — a different lens from the by-year chart, which splits each award across the years it was committed.
- Names come raw
Recipient names appear exactly as filed, and the government doesn't standardize them, so one organization can show up under a few spelling variants — worth checking near-duplicates before sizing one up.
